Who’s Leading the Bar Program at Cayman’s Kimpton Seafire

By: Caribbean Journal Staff - September 29, 2016

The highly-anticipated Kimpton Seafire Resort in Grand Cayman is opening in November, and it’s already tabbed its new beverage manager.

Kimpton veteran John Stanton will be leading the bar program at the property, joining the resort from Sable Kitchen & Bar in Chicago, where he had been head bartender.

“I am excited to further my career with Kimpton and look forward to joining the culinary community of Grand Cayman,” Stanton said. “With a focus on celebrating the best ingredients the island has to offer, I hope to create a bar program that both locals and resort guests will enjoy.”

Stanton has been one of Chicago’s top bartenders for some time, beginning at a dive bar called the Hungry Brain and helping to open Sable.

He will be overseeing the bar program at three dining venues at Seafire: Ave, the Mediterranean-inspired eatery; Avecita, a “chef’s bar” and Coccoloba, a street-taco stand.

The hotel said the plan was to create “handmade cocktails infused with local Caymanian flavors.”
